Wrangle Your Way Out: Debt Settlement Strategies

Drowning in debt can feel overwhelming, but you're not alone. Millions face with similar financial challenges every year. The good news is that there are proven methods to regain control of your finances and minimize your debts.

Debt settlement involves negotiating with your creditors to reach a smaller payment amount, effectively mitigating the financial burden you're shouldering.

A skilled negotiator can sometimes convince creditors to consider a settlement that's substantially manageable for your circumstances.

While debt settlement can be a valuable tool, it's crucial to understand the consequences. Before embarking on this path, consult a reputable financial advisor to assess if debt settlement is the right choice for your unique goals.

Minimize Payments: A Guide to Loan Consolidation Options

Are you overwhelmed with several loan payments each month? Consider considering loan consolidation as a effective solution to consolidate your finances and maybe reduce your monthly payments. By combining various loans into one new loan, you can streamline your repayment process and potentially gain a decreased interest rate.
